| Newspapers increasingly use streaming videos |
| Wednesday, 15 September 2010 00:00 |
|
A new survey shows that newspapers are increasingly using streaming video in the digital editions of their publications.
According to a report from BrightCove and TubeMogul, the 65 per cent of newspapers are now using streaming video, with deployment surging in the second quarter of this year. The Online Video and the Media Industry Quarterly Research report revealed that online streaming video consumption increased across all media categories, while the proportion of unique visitors to websites increased by an average of 2.8 per cent a month. The report also revealed that consumers watched 11 per cent more online streaming videos month-over-month compared to the last quarter. Furthermore, almost two-thirds (60 per cent) of brand marketers said they plan to invest more of their budgets in online video over the next 12 months, with 70 per cent of respondents saying they plan to add mobile video to their marketing mix over the same period. ![]() |
